Dynamic pressure vent for canal hearing devices
First Claim
1. A dynamic pressure vent of a compliant acoustical sealing element for a canal hearing device, the dynamic pressure vent comprising:
- a flexible membrane provided along a medial surface of the compliant acoustical sealing element; and
one or more flaps formed by one or more slits within the flexible membrane, wherein the one or more flaps are configured to temporarily deform and open in response to an air pressure gradient across the flexible membrane while inside an ear canal, wherein the one or more flaps are formed in a region between a sound port and a contact portion of the compliant acoustic sealing element.

Abstract
A seal assembly for canal hearing devices including a dynamic pressure vent formed and defined by diaphragmatic flaps configured to open in response to a pressure gradient across the diaphragm. The seal assembly comprises a compliant seal element configured to be positioned generally concentrically around the canal hearing device for providing comfortable contact with the ear canal and for acoustically sealing the residual volume of the ear canal. The seal assembly is preferably made of an elastomeric material. The dynamic pressure vent is substantially closed in the normal position to minimize feedback, while momentarily opening inside the ear canal during insertion or removal of the canal hearing device into or from the ear canal.
